# XiaoZhi AI Chatbot

## Project Purpose
This project is developed based on Espressif's ESP-IDF.
This is an open-source project primarily for educational purposes. Through this project, we aim to help more people get started with AI hardware development and understand how to integrate rapidly evolving large language models into actual hardware devices. Whether you're a student interested in AI or a developer looking to explore new technologies, this project offers valuable learning experiences.

## Implemented Features
- Wi-Fi / ML307 Cat.1 4G
- BOOT button wake-up and interrupt, supporting both click and long-press triggers
- Offline voice wake-up [ESP-SR](https://github.com/espressif/esp-sr)
- Streaming voice dialogue (WebSocket or UDP protocol)
- Support for 5 languages: Mandarin, Cantonese, English, Japanese, Korean [SenseVoice](https://github.com/FunAudioLLM/SenseVoice)
- Voice print recognition to identify who's calling AI's name [3D Speaker](https://github.com/modelscope/3D-Speaker)
- Large model TTS (Volcengine or CosyVoice)
- Large Language Model (Qwen2.5 72B or Doubao API)
- Configurable prompts and voice tones (custom characters)
- Short-term memory with self-summary after each conversation round
- OLED / LCD display showing signal strength or conversation content

### Development Environment
- Cursor or VSCode
- Install ESP-IDF plugin, select SDK version 5.3 or above
- Linux is preferred over Windows for faster compilation and fewer driver issues
